 
body {
  background-repeat: no-repeat;
  background-color: #0000ff;
  background-position: top;
  color: #eee;
}
.site {
  p { text-indent:6em;}
}
.back {
  /* content:url("ch.png"); */
}
.red {
  color: #ff0000;
}

.header {
  padding: 1em;
  /* text-align: center; */
  color: #222;
}
.myClass:before {
  color: #eee;
  display: inline-block;
  width: 32px;
  height: 32px;
  /* content: "XX";*/
  content:url("form0.html");
  background-image: url("blue.jpeg");
}
.silent{
  scrollbar-width: 0;
}
.main {
  padding: 1em;
  flex: 1;
  /* overflow-y: scroll; */
  scrollbar-width: none;
}

.footer {
  margin-left: -350;
  padding: 0px;
  text-align: left;
  position: fixed;
  bottom: 0;
}
:root {
--header: 3rem;
--footer: 40px;
--main: calc(100vh - calc(var(--header) + var(--footer)));
}
:root {
  --container-size: min(90vw, 90vh);
  --star-size: min(5vw, 5vh);
  --star-lg: polygon(
    calc(50% + 50% * cos(270deg)) calc(50% + 50% * sin(270deg)),
    calc(50% + 50% * cos( 54deg)) calc(50% + 50% * sin( 54deg)),
    calc(50% + 50% * cos(198deg)) calc(50% + 50% * sin(198deg)),
    calc(50% + 50% * cos(342deg)) calc(50% + 50% * sin(342deg)),
    calc(50% + 50% * cos(126deg)) calc(50% + 50% * sin(126deg))
  );
  --star-sm: polygon(
    calc(var(--star-size) + var(--star-size) * cos(270deg)) calc(var(--star-size) + var(--star-size) * sin(270deg)),
    calc(var(--star-size) + var(--star-size) * cos( 54deg)) calc(var(--star-size) + var(--star-size) * sin( 54deg)),
    calc(var(--star-size) + var(--star-size) * cos(198deg)) calc(var(--star-size) + var(--star-size) * sin(198deg)),
    calc(var(--star-size) + var(--star-size) * cos(342deg)) calc(var(--star-size) + var(--star-size) * sin(342deg)),
    calc(var(--star-size) + var(--star-size) * cos(126deg)) calc(var(--star-size) + var(--star-size) * sin(126deg))
  );
}


background-image: image("image.jpeg#xywh=0,20,40,60");


